Men's Basketball Announces Two Exhibition Games

10/14/2021 12:30:00 PM | Men's Basketball

The Eagles will travel to Oakland for a charity game, Oct. 28, and host Goshen, Nov. 5

YPSILANTI, Mich. (EMUEagles.com) -- The Eastern Michigan University men's basketball program and first-year Head Coach Stan Heath announced the addition of two exhibition games to the 2021-22 schedule today, Oct. 14. 

The Eagles will travel to Oakland University Thursday, Oct. 28, at 7 p.m. for a charity game. All ticket proceeds from the contest against the Golden Grizzlies will go to Covenant Academy, a Health Care Education training school that assists in filling the critical health care professional shortage in Michigan due to the COVID-19 pandemic. Ticket will be $10 each for all seating options other than courtside seating. 

Eastern will Goshen College Friday, Nov. 5., at 7 p.m. inside the Convocation Center. Admission is free for all attendees. All fans must wear a face-covering regardless of COVID-19 vaccination status. 

EMU has close ties to Goshen as the Leafs' Head Coach, Jon Tropf is an EMU alum. He spent four years as a men's basketball manager, including three as the head manager. In 2011-12, he was part of an Eagles program that won the West Division of the Mid-American Conference for the first time in school history.
